From Seed to Shelf
The core loop begins with planting banana trees on available soil. Once the fruit ripens, you collect it and place it on counters for customers to purchase. Some bananas go toward feeding chickens, which produce fresh eggs for sale. This simple cycle of planting, harvesting, and restocking forms the foundation of your daily routine.
Expanding Your Product Line
As you earn coins from sales, you can invest in new production stations that unlock additional goods. Bananas can be turned into puree, while flour and milk open the door to baked items like bread. Each new product type attracts more customers and increases your earning potential.
Keeping Customers Satisfied
The key to steady income is maintaining well-stocked shelves. If counters run empty, shoppers will leave, reducing your profits. You must monitor stock levels and prioritize refilling popular items. Upgrades that speed up production or add extra storage help you meet demand more efficiently.

Progression and Growth
Your market evolves gradually as you reinvest earnings into new equipment and expanded facilities. What begins as a small stand eventually becomes a sprawling marketplace with multiple counters and product types. The sense of steady progress keeps the experience engaging without requiring complex strategies.
